Career path

Career Role Description
Donor Relations Manager (Fundraising) Cultivates and manages relationships with major donors, securing significant philanthropic gifts. Key skills: relationship management, fundraising, communication.
Fundraising Officer (Charity) Supports the Donor Relations Manager, focusing on donor stewardship and engagement. Key skills: event planning, communication, database management.
Grants & Trusts Officer (Philanthropy) Research and writes grant proposals to secure funding from trusts and foundations. Key skills: proposal writing, research, grant writing.
Major Gifts Officer (Development) Focuses on cultivating and soliciting major gifts from high-net-worth individuals. Key skills: relationship building, solicitation, negotiation.
